Fullmetal Alchemist: Episode 29




Give me a few more episodes like this one, and I would definitely pledge my undying loyalty to Hiromu-sensei. While the treatment for most of the scenes were deceivingly light, surprises and character development filled the entire episode.
Ignoring Ed’s protests, Izumi brought the mystery kid along with her. She fed and dressed the child as if he was her own. The kid had no memory of his past nor any idea of his identity. His skills in alchemy along with his questionable identity caused doubts on Ed and Al. The highly suspicious nature of the brothers forced them to explain themselves to Izumi. Only then, Izumi realized how dangerous it has become her apprentices. Although she only showed kindness to the strange boy, she herself have her own theories on his real identity. She forced Ed to remember the moments when he and his brother used the forbidden technique. Ed somewhat understood the importance of what he discovered from the experience however, it was incomplete. Izumi offered no explanation to enlighten the confused Ed. She then went back to the island and sought out answers to her nagging doubts.
Meanwhile, Ed and Al are adamant for straight answers that they once again disregarded their teacher’s orders. Instead of staying put in their room and not bother the kid, they questioned him in a very rough manner that the poor kid had no choice but to run away from them.
I can see where Ed and Al are coming from but their insensitive actions and lack of thought proves their immaturity. They are still children walking among adults. Izumi on the other hand, has wisdom enough to know how to approach certain things. The Elric’s impatience could cause them dearly, later on. Although Izumi implied that the kid isn’t one of the homunculus, he could still be one of them. If these creatures are made up of pieces of human flesh and get their parts from different individuals, the kid’s alchemy use must have came from Ed’s right arm.
Alchemy without the circle is hinted to be caused by practicing the forbidden human transmutation. Izumi may have tried the technique before. She knows about the homunculus more than she lets on.
